Free Parking at Resorts with a Catch

While some casinos offer completely free parking, others have specific conditions attached.

  • Hotel Guests: Most casinos now offer free self-parking for hotel guests. This is a great incentive to book your stay directly with the casino and can save you a significant amount of money over multiple days.
  • Dining, Shopping, and Entertainment: Some casinos offer free parking for a limited time if you dine at their restaurants, shop at their stores, or attend a show. Be sure to check the terms and conditions before you park.
  • Loyalty Programs: Casinos often reward loyal patrons with free parking perks, so signing up for their player’s club can be beneficial.

Tips for Navigating Free Parking

  • Plan Ahead: Before you head to the Strip, check the parking policies of the casinos you plan to visit.
  • Arrive Early: Parking lots can fill up quickly, especially during peak hours and weekends.
  • Utilize Valet Parking: While valet parking typically comes with a fee, it can be a convenient option if you’re short on time or energy.
  • Read the Signs: Pay attention to parking signage, as there may be specific rules or restrictions for certain areas.
